Ingredients and spices that need to be Make ready to make Buttered Corn & Tuna ala Pinoy:
- Century Tuna 1 can (155g)
- Jolly Whole Corn 1 can (425g)
- Cube butter
- 1/4 cup minced Onion
- Salt and Pepper
Instructions to make to make Buttered Corn & Tuna ala Pinoy
- In medium heat, melt butter in a saucepan and sauté the onion until translucent.
- Add tuna and wait until it turns to an appealing brown shade.
- Add corn. Wait for it to simmer then sprinkle salt and pepper to taste. Ready to serve a minute after.
